About Us: TherapyWorks is a multidisciplinary practice with a vibrant team of Nurse Practitioner, Social Worker and Clinical Counsellors, Occupational Therapists, Youth Development Facilitators, and Specialized Educational Support Workers. Together, we support clients across the lifespan—many of those who are neurodiverse or have complex learning, mental health, and developmental needs. Our practice prioritizes a flexible, “meet the client where they’re at” approach, fostering creativity and neurodiversity-affirming, trauma-informed care.
Our clinical environment is supportive and lively. We value authenticity and encourage team members to bring their whole selves to work, creating a space where clinicians feel as supported as our clients.
Position Overview: We’re seeking a Registered Clinical Social Worker to enrich our assessment team and help us meet growing demands for ADHD and mental health diagnostic assessments, and associated therapeutic interventions. While assessment and diagnosis are the priorities for this role, Clinical Social Workers interested in augmenting their hours, with Mental Health Counselling, Couple’s Therapy, or Group Therapy, are encouraged to apply. This is a part-time independent contractor position with flexibility for increased hours if desired.

Ideal Candidate Profile:
- Qualifications (Required): Registration in BC as a Registered Clinical Social Worker.
- Experience: 1-5 years in assessing and supporting children, youth, and adults with developmental, emotional, or behavioral challenges.
- Skills: Proficiency in diagnosing ADHD and potential differential diagnoses. Awareness of PDA profile in Autism and the collaborative approaches most successful in facilitating participation. Assessment of Autistic Adults is beneficial.
- Therapeutic Techniques: Training in Play Therapy,
EMDR, Brainspotting, IFS, Family or Couple’s Therapy, or DBT, is beneficial, with adaptability for diverse learning and communication styles, for those wishing to augment the assessment role with psychotherapy services.
- Additional Requirements: Professional liability insurance (general liability recommended), a vulnerable sector criminal record check, and a commitment to ethical, client-centered practice.
